Coast Guard E-6 EPME
The Coast Guard Seal (1927) - correct answer ✔The CG symbol used
primarily on documents, records, and jewelry


March 1, 2003 - correct answer ✔What date did the Coast Guard become
part of the Department of Homeland Security?


1910 - correct answer ✔What year did Semper Paratus appear on the CG
Ensign?


Captain Francis Saltus Von Boskerck in 1922 aboard the Cutter YAMACRAW,
added music to it in 1927 in Unalaska, Alaska - correct answer ✔Who wrote
Semper Paratus?


Pt Cruz, Guadalcanal - correct answer ✔Where was Signalman First Class
Douglas Munro killed?


Sep 27, 1942 - correct answer ✔What date was Signalman First Class
Douglas Munro killed?


1922, prior to he was a citizen of British Columbia (Canada) - correct answer
✔When did Douglas Munro become a US citizen?


Purple Heart, American Defense Service Medal, Asiatic-Pacific Campaign
Medal, and the World War II Victory Medal - correct answer ✔What other
awards did Signalman First Class Douglass Munro earn besides a Navy
MOH?

,Harriet Lane in Charleston Harbor - correct answer ✔Who is credited for
firing the first naval shot of the civil war?


Quasi-war, in which 18 prizes were captured - correct answer ✔What war did
congress authorize the capture of armed French vessels hovering off the U.S.
coast?


Mexican-American War - correct answer ✔When was the first time ever that
steamboats were used in a war?


The War of 1812 - correct answer ✔In what war did the Cutter Jefferson
capture the first prize?


The 1822 Timber Reserve Act for the U.S. Navy - correct answer ✔The CG
mission to protect the environment had its beginnings when?


April 2, 1917, WW I - correct answer ✔On what date was the entire Coast
Guard, manpower, vessels and units, transferred to the Navy?


September 26, 1918 - correct answer ✔On what date presumably was the
CGC Tampa torpedoed by a German Submarine?


1918 - correct answer ✔What year did Genevieve and Lucille Baker of the
Naval Coastal Defense Reserve become the first uniformed women in the
CG?


New Jersey and Long Island - correct answer ✔What two coasts that
experienced the most ship wrecks, were chosen for the new stations of the
Federal Lifesaving Service in 1848?

, Boston Light - correct answer ✔The only CG manned light station is what?


Wreck master - correct answer ✔A community leader that was put in charge
of the station was usually a what?


1848 - correct answer ✔When did the Federal Life Saving Service come into
existence?


Sumner L. Kimball - correct answer ✔The Life-Saving Service was "reborn"
in 1871 under the leadership of whom?


The sinking of the Titanic - correct answer ✔What was the driving force of
the International Ice Patrol?


Cannons - correct answer ✔In colonial times during fog, what was used to
warn ships away from land?


Ida Lewis - correct answer ✔Who served 39 yrs at Lime Rock Lighthouse,
and was credited for saving 18 lives?


Alexander Hamilton - correct answer ✔Who ordered that the Revenue
Marine Officers be commissioned?


1789 - correct answer ✔What year were all lighthouses federalized?


LT E.F. Stone - correct answer ✔Who was the Co-Pilot in the first Trans-
Atlantic flight?


1941 - correct answer ✔What year were the CG reserves created?
